Hi I was wondering whether anyone has successfully requested a MAC code from their broadband supplier by post rather than by phoning them. Reason for asking: I know I will be kept on the phone for a while being passed from person to person then put on hold etc trying to sell me a new deal etc etc before I eventually get my request authorised. I've made up my mind I want to move supplier, so a simple letter sent through the post would be far quicker and convenient for me. So is it worth it, are they obliged to send me a MAC in return, or should I just endure the phone? Thanks.

I believe that the MAC process as dictated by OFCOM,requires ISPs to provide two methods of requesting a MAC.
For instance, Plusnet its over the phone or by post., but not via their ticket system or email.
HOWEVER, I'm led to believe that some ISPs (SKY??) make it virtually impossible to ask for a MAC by any other means than the phone. If you write they just reply asking you to phone them !!!
Think that you are better biting the bullet and phoning!0
